What is Crack Chicken?

Crack chicken is chicken breasts or thighs mixed with addictive ingredients that create an irresistible flavor. The term "crack" refers to the dish's highly craveable taste. While the recipes vary, they often contain cheese, ranch dressing, bacon, and other rich ingredients. The chicken soaks up the flavors, resulting in a dish so good, you won't want to stop eating it. Crack chicken recipes are easy to throw together and make excellent family meals.

Crack Chicken Casserole

This cheesy casserole is a crowd-pleasing family favorite. Kids and adults alike will be going back for seconds.

Ingredients:

  • 2 lbs chicken breasts, diced
  • 1 (10.75 oz) can cream of chicken soup
  • 1 (10.75 oz) can cream of mushroom soup
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 packet ranch seasoning mix
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 lb bacon, cooked and crumbled
  • 1 cup crushed crackers
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F.
  2. In a large bowl, mix the chicken, soups, sour cream, ranch seasoning, 1 cup of cheese, and bacon.
  3. Pour the mixture into a 9x13 baking dish.
  4. Top with the remaining 1 cup of cheese and crushed crackers.
  5. Bake for 30 minutes until bubbly and golden brown.
  6. Let cool 5 minutes before serving.

This cheesy crack chicken casserole is irresistible comfort food. The creaminess pairs perfectly with the crunchy crackers on top. Make it on a busy weeknight or bring it to a potluck. Either way, it's sure to be gobbled up fast.

Crockpot Ranch Crack Chicken

Let your slow cooker do the work with this easy set-it-and-forget ranch chicken. It's perfect for busy weeknights.

Ingredients:

  • 3 lbs chicken breasts
  • 1 (1 oz) packet ranch dressing mix
  • 1/2 cup butter, melted
  • 8 oz cream cheese, cubed
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th

Instructions:

  1. Place chicken in slow cooker and sprinkle with ranch dressing mix.
  2. In a bowl, mix together melted butter, cream cheese, and chicken broth. Pour over chicken.
  3. Cook on high 3-4 hours or low 6-8 hours until chicken is cooked through and shreds easily.
  4. Shred chicken with two forks. Mix with sauce.
  5. Serve over rice, with pasta, or on buns for easy sandwiches.

The creamy, peppery ranch flavor coats every bite of this crockpot crack chicken. A few minutes of prep in the morning means dinner is ready when you walk in the door. Now that's an easy family meal!

Crack Chicken Pasta Bake

Creamy, cheesy, and loaded with chicken, this pasta bake will be your new family favorite dinner.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b penne pasta
  • 2 cups shredded rotisserie chicken
  • 1 (16 oz) jar Alfredo sauce
  • 1 (15 oz) container ricotta cheese
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an
  • Chopped parsley for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F. Grease a 9x13 baking dish.
  2. Cook pasta according to package directions until al dente. Drain.
  3. In a large bowl, mix pasta, chicken, Alfredo sauce, ricotta, and 1 cup mozzarella.
  4. Pour mixture into prepared baking dish. Top with remaining 1 cup mozzarella and Parmesan.
  5. Bake for 20 minutes until hot and bubbly.
  6. Garnish with chopped parsley before serving.

Kids love cheesy pasta bakes, and this chicken Alfredo version is a guaranteed crowd-pleaser. Just layer everything in the baking dish, bake, and you've got dinner on the table in under an hour.
